    Miconazole, sold under the brand name Monistat among others, is an antifungal medication used to treat ring worm, pityriasis versicolor, and yeast infections of the skin or vagina. [2] It is used for ring worm of the body, groin (jock itch), and feet (athlete's foot). [2] It is applied to the skin or vagina as a cream or ointment. [2] [3]

    Tioconazole ointments serve to treat women's vaginal yeast infections. [1] They are available in one day doses, as opposed to the 7-day treatments commonly used in the past. Tioconazole topical (skin) preparations are also available for ringworm , jock itch , athlete's foot , and tinea versicolor or "sun fungus".

    Clotrimazole is an imidazole derivative that works by inhibiting the growth of individual Candida or fungal cells by altering the permeability of the fungal cell wall. [7] The drug impairs the biosynthesis of ergosterol, a critical component of the fungal cell membrane, by inhibiting the P450 enzyme lanosterol 14-alpha demethylase. [19]
